Abstract

A system and method for remotely displaying a plurality of data items is disclosed. The system determines a total quantity of displayable data items and optionally receives an indication of a display control size from a remote client. The server stores a threshold value indicating a relationship between a quantity of data items and a size of a display control. The server compares the quantity of data items and the received indication of the display control size. If the comparison exceeds the threshold value, the server sends a subset of the items to the remote client for display, and sends additional items as requested by the remote client. If the comparison is less than the threshold value, the server sends each of the items to the remote client for display. The server repeats this comparison for changes in the quantity of data items or the size of the display control.

Claims (50)

1. A method of displaying a plurality of items at a remote location, the method comprising:

storing a display control dimension which is indicative of a quantity of items which are simultaneously displayable at the remote location;

storing a threshold value which is indicative of a quantity of items which is greater than the quantity of items which are simultaneously displayable at the remote location;

storing the plurality of items;

determining a quantity associated with the plurality of items;

receiving a request for data representing the plurality of items from the remote location;

determining a relationship value indicative of a relationship between the display control dimension and the quantity associated with the plurality of items;

comparing the relationship value to the threshold value;

conditioned on the relationship value exceeding the threshold value, sending the data representing the plurality of items to the remote location for display; and

conditioned on the relationship value not exceeding the threshold value, sending a subset of the data representing the plurality of items to the remote location for display.
